Comprehending Window Scratches

Before diving into the repair techniques, it’s important to understand the nature of window scratches. Scratches on windows can vary in depth and severity:

  • Surface Scratches: These are the most typical and are typically shallow. They can be triggered by dust, dirt, or small abrasions. Surface area scratches are typically easy to repair.
  • Deep Scratches: These are more serious and can penetrate much deeper into the glass. They are frequently brought on by more difficult products like metal or stones. Deep scratches are more tough to repair and might require professional intervention.
  • Pitted Scratches: These are little, deep scratches that develop a pitted or engraved appearance. Pitted scratches are typically the outcome of extended exposure to extreme chemicals or environmental factors.

DIY Methods for Repairing Window Scratches

1. Tooth paste Method

Among the most popular and cost-effective techniques for Repairing window surface scratches is using tooth paste. Here’s how to do it:

  • Materials Needed: Non-gel, non-whitening toothpaste, a microfiber fabric, and a soft-bristled brush.
  • Actions:
    1. Clean the window thoroughly to eliminate any dirt or debris.
    2. Apply a percentage of tooth paste to the scratch.
    3. Use a soft-bristled brush to gently rub the tooth paste into the scratch in a circular movement.
    4. Clean away the tooth paste with a microfiber fabric.
    5. Rinse the window with water and dry it with a tidy cloth.

2. Baking Soda and Water Paste

Another efficient DIY method includes using a basic mixture of baking soda and water:

  • Materials Needed: Baking soda, water, a microfiber cloth, and a soft-bristled brush.
  • Steps:
    1. Clean the window to get rid of any dirt or particles.
    2. Mix baking soda and water to form a paste.
    3. Use the paste to the scratch and utilize a soft-bristled brush to carefully rub it in a circular movement.
    4. Wipe away the paste with a microfiber cloth.
    5. Wash the window with water and dry it with a clean cloth.

3. Vinegar and Baking Soda

This technique combines the cleansing power of vinegar with the abrasive residential or commercial properties of baking soda:

  • Materials Needed: White vinegar, baking soda, a microfiber fabric, and a soft-bristled brush.
  • Actions:
    1. Clean the window to eliminate any dirt or debris.
    2. Mix equal parts white vinegar and baking soda to form a paste.
    3. Use the paste to the scratch and use a soft-bristled brush to carefully rub it in a circular motion.
    4. Wipe away the paste with a microfiber fabric.
    5. Rinse the window with water and dry it with a tidy cloth.

4. Specialized Glass Polishing Kits

For more severe scratches, specialized glass polishing packages are available. These kits often contain a polishing compound and a buffer:

  • Materials Needed: Glass polishing set, microfiber cloth, and a buffer (electrical or manual).
  • Steps:
    1. Clean the window to remove any dirt or debris.
    2. Apply the polishing substance to the scratch according to the set’s directions.
    3. Use the buffer to carefully polish the scratch in a circular motion.
    4. Clean away the compound with a microfiber cloth.
    5. Wash the window with water and dry it with a tidy fabric.

Expert Window Scratch Repair

For deep or pitted scratches, DIY approaches may not suffice. In such cases, it’s suggested to look for professional aid. Specialist window scratch repair services can offer the following:

  • Advanced Polishing Techniques: Professionals use top quality polishing compounds and specialized devices to get rid of deep scratches.
  • Replacement Services: If the scratch is unfathomable to repair, specialists can replace the harmed window pane.
  • Warranty: Many expert services offer a warranty on their work, ensuring that the repair is lasting.

Avoiding Window Scratches

Prevention is constantly better than treatment. Here are some tips to avoid window scratches:

  • Regular Cleaning: Clean your windows frequently utilizing a gentle, non-abrasive cleaner to eliminate dirt and particles.
  • Use Soft Cloths: Always use microfiber or other soft cloths to clean your windows to avoid scratching the glass.
  • Safeguard from Harsh Conditions: Use window coverings or blinds to safeguard your windows from direct sunshine and harsh weather.
  • Prevent Harsh Chemicals: Avoid utilizing harsh chemicals or abrasive products that can harm the glass.

Frequently asked questions

1. Can I repair deep scratches on my windows myself?

  • Deep scratches are more challenging to repair and may need expert intervention. Do it yourself approaches can in some cases assist, however they might not entirely remove the scratch.

2. What is the very best DIY method for eliminating surface area scratches?

  • The tooth paste approach is among the most reliable and cost-effective DIY methods for eliminating surface scratches. It is easy to do and often yields great results.

3. Will utilizing a glass polishing package damage my windows?

  • When used correctly, a glass polishing set should not harm your windows. Nevertheless, it’s crucial to follow the guidelines thoroughly and use a gentle touch to prevent causing further damage.

4. Just how much does professional window scratch repair expense?

  • The expense of expert window scratch repair can vary depending on the seriousness of the scratch and the size of the window. Typically, it can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 200 per window.

5. Can I use vinegar alone to get rid of window scratches?

  • Vinegar alone is ineffective for getting rid of window scratches. However, when combined with baking soda, it can form a powerful cleansing solution that can help in reducing the look of surface scratches.
